With AmaZulu having recently unveiled a brand new basketball collection for fans, Royal AM owner Shauwn Mkhize was also spotted rocking a full basketball kit this week. This begs the question; what is with KwaZulu-Natal teams and their newly found love for the American sport?

The story

On Thursday, the AM boss posted several images on Instagram rocking the Atlanta Hawks' full kit on an outdoor court. It is unclear why she wore the NBA team's full attire but is it perhaps a coincidence that AmaZulu actually released basketball fanwear last week as well?

Mkhize's captain did little in terms of giving any clues, as she simply wrote: "Slam Dunk. Taking a small break from soccer and joining the “six foot” gang on the basketball court.

"@slabmmg [American music artist Whole Slab] I am ready for our next one on one ?????? This really reminds me of my tomboy days.

"One thing about me, I easily adapt to any situation. Put me on a soccer field and I’ll score a goal, put me on a basketball court and I’ll take a free throw! That’s what keeps me going.

"Get too comfortable and you lose sight of the ball/prize. Have a great Thursday fam."

Maybe the KZN teams are planning a little basketball tournament, who knows? Nevertheless, on the football pitch, very little separates the two sides, although Usuthu sits in the top half of the table, while Thwihli Thwahla are struggling in the bottom half.

Just one point separates them though, with the latter outfit set to take on Kaizer Chiefs of Sunday, a side they are yet to lose against since joining the DStv Premiership in 2021/22. Meanwhile, Romain Folz's side will battle second-placed Richards Bay United in another KZN derby.

Did you know?

On head-to-head, Royal AM have won all three of their games against The Glamour Boys, boasting a 6-1 scoreline on aggregate.
